devpts: factor out PTY index allocation



Factor out the code used to allocate/free a pts index into new interfaces,
devpts_new_index() and devpts_kill_index().  This localizes the external data
structures used in managing the pts indices.

int devpts_new_index(void)
{
	int index;
	int idr_ret;

retry:
	if (!idr_pre_get(&allocated_ptys, GFP_KERNEL)) {
		return -ENOMEM;
	}

	mutex_lock(&allocated_ptys_lock);
	idr_ret = idr_get_new(&allocated_ptys, NULL, &index);
	if (idr_ret < 0) {
		mutex_unlock(&allocated_ptys_lock);
		if (idr_ret == -EAGAIN)
			goto retry;
		return -EIO;
	}

	if (index >= pty_limit) {
		idr_remove(&allocated_ptys, index);
		mutex_unlock(&allocated_ptys_lock);
		return -EIO;
	}
	mutex_unlock(&allocated_ptys_lock);
	return index;
}

void devpts_kill_index(int idx)
{
	mutex_lock(&allocated_ptys_lock);
	idr_remove(&allocated_ptys, idx);
	mutex_unlock(&allocated_ptys_lock);
}
